VP, Product (Remote - US)

Remote Full-time
At TixTrack, we support our clients by creating superior ticketing solutions for performing arts and cultural institutions through a combination of modern technology, beautifully simple design, and the art of listening.

Headquartered in the heart of the Broadway Theatre District, NYC, we are a small, but growing team of hardworking, highly motivated individuals. We are passionate about our work and driven to innovate with our customers to solve current and future challenges with new solutions.

Our core product, Nliven, is a real-time platform that helps venues manage ticket sales efficiently while creating a more engaging buying experience for customers. With a presence across both the US and UK, we are anticipating robust growth in 2026.

About The Role

We are seeking a VP, Product to serve as the operational strategist and cultural architect of our Product organization. This is not a status-quo maintenance role. You will partner with the key stakeholders, including the Executive Team, to operationalize our high-level vision, helping us deliver a product roadmap that serves the many needs of Performing Arts Theaters and propels our next leg of business growth.

You will help us move further towards the Empowered Teams model, prioritizing collaborative dynamic process and communication with Engineering, Product, and Design. You will be the bridge between our technical transformation and our commercial success, working closely with Customer Success and Strategy & Growth to balance client needs with long-term platform health. This role, reporting to the CTO, is responsible for guiding the process for the Nliven and Tixtrack Pro’s product and design lifecycles, ensuring successful product launches and alignment with company goals.

This position is full-time and fully remote. Candidates are preferred to be located in New York, New Jersey, or Connecticut, but we will consider candidates located in California, Oregon, Colorado, Texas, Wisconsin, Minnesota, Louisiana, Florida, Virginia, North Carolina, and South Carolina. Candidates may be required to travel and/or meet up in-person from time to time. There may also be an expectation in the future for hybrid work in a local office.
About You
• The Operator-Strategist: You excel at balancing strategic thinking with tactical execution. You love taking a big-picture vision and building the "machine" (process, people, data) to deliver it.
• The Coach: You have a track record of mentoring PMs and Designers. You measure your own success by how many leaders you grow, not just how many features you ship.
• The Tech-Fluent: You don’t need to have coded, but you understand the complexity of SaaS at scale. You can speak the language of engineering and understand the trade-offs between technical debt and new features.
• The Diplomat: You have high emotional intelligence and can navigate friction with Customer Success and Sales, turning any potential conflict into alignment.

What You'll Do
• Act as the primary strategic bridge between Product and Customer Success/Strategy & Growth. Move the organization away from "roadmap negotiation" toward objective-based planning.
• Partner with the CTO to translate our Product Vision into actionable quarterly strategies, roadmaps, and goals.
• Bring rigor to our decision-making. Data is your compass; you will drive the research, market data, and feedback loops that inform why we build what we build.
• Move beyond traditional backlog management to deep coaching. Dedicate significant bandwidth to further developing our Product Managers into excellent product thinkers who own value and viability, while aligning the team around a shared product management approach.
• Foster a culture of "missionaries, not mercenaries," where teams are accountable for business outcomes (retention, revenue), not just feature output.
• Guide the team in adopting modern discovery techniques to validate ideas before we build, ensuring we only ship what matters.
• Manage the "Build vs. Partner" decisions as we expand our ecosystem.
• Collaborate with the VP of Engineering to ensure our team topology evolves alongside our architecture and team growth. As we break up the Nliven monolith, you will ensure our product domains are set up to minimize dependencies and maximize team autonomy.
• Partner with the VP, Customer Experience to manage customer-facing product rollouts and coordinate feedback to ultimately sustainably improve customer satisfaction in our products.
• Treat our infrastructure, platform, and developer experience as a product, understanding that speed, quality, and reliability are features our customers feel.
• Protect the team's focus. You will be the shield that prevents stakeholder thrash, allowing your PMs to focus on deep work while you manage executive expectations.
